Ace of Pentacles Overview: Solid Ground, Solid Intentions
The Ace of Pentacles belongs to the suit of Earth (Pentacles), ruling the material world: health, finances, security, and practical value.
Element: Earth
Zodiac Signs: Taurus, Virgo, Capricorn
Keywords: Stability, new beginnings, potential, security, groundedness
As a person, this card indicates someone who is:
- Reliable and emotionally anchored
- Intent on building—not just talking
- May not express themselves through words—but through effort and consistency
- Brings new beginnings with lasting potential

✅ Upright Ace of Pentacles as a Person: The Giver of Opportunity
When upright, this person is:
- Grounded, dependable, and practical
- Intent on offering real value—be it time, support, gifts, or effort
- A slow starter—but someone who follows through
- May open doors for new beginnings in love, career, or spiritual growth
Traits of the Upright Ace of Pentacles Person:
Quality | How It Manifests |
---|---|
Reliable and practical | Always shows up, handles tasks, keeps their word |
Generous and resourceful | Offers help, ideas, or money without expecting praise |
New beginning energy | You feel like “something solid” is starting when they enter your life |
Rooted and nurturing | Helps you feel safe and stable—emotionally or financially |

⚠️ Reversed Ace of Pentacles as a Person: Withheld Potential, Missed Opportunities
In reversed form, the Ace of Pentacles person may:
- Appear promising but fails to follow through
- Offer security or investment—only to withdraw it later
- Value status or money over emotional connection
- Present themselves as grounded—but have hidden instability
Traits of the Reversed Ace of Pentacles Person:
Shadow Trait | How It Shows Up |
---|---|
Withholding energy | Promises support or commitment but delays or avoids it |
Fear of investment | Emotionally guarded, financially risk-averse, overly cautious |
Material over emotional | Focuses on money, looks, or “what’s in it for them” |
Stuck or stagnant | Can’t start new things or keeps repeating the same safe patterns |

Ace of Pentacles as a Person in Love & Relationships
This person sees love as an investment. They’re not the type to fall head over heels overnight—but once they choose you, their love is long-lasting and rooted in action.
What They’re Like in Love:
- They show love through consistency, gifts, or acts of service
- They take their time—but mean what they offer
- They want relationships that feel safe, predictable, and future-oriented
- Their love language might be financial support, physical presence, or providing for you
You Know You’ve Met an Ace of Pentacles Lover When:
Love Pattern | Real-Life Clues |
---|---|
Gives instead of talks | Buys you a thoughtful item, pays attention to your needs |
Offers stability | Talks about a future, home, career, or shared goals |
Emotionally rooted | Their energy feels like home—even if they aren’t overly expressive |
Values loyalty | Tests trust before opening up—but commits deeply once ready |

Tarot Pairings That Reveal More About the Ace of Pentacles Person
Tarot is never one-dimensional. Use pairings to understand the nuances of this person’s role and presence in your life:
Card Pairing | Interpretation |
---|---|
Ace of Pentacles + The Empress | They are nurturing, abundant, and ready for emotional and physical growth |
Ace of Pentacles + The Lovers | They want to build a long-term relationship—but with shared values |
Ace of Pentacles + The Star | Their presence is healing, hopeful, and spiritually aligned |
Ace of Pentacles + The Devil | They may struggle with materialism or fear of emotional risk |
Ace of Pentacles + Knight of Pentacles | Strong commitment energy—slow and steady pursuit of something lasting |

Ace of Pentacles as a Person in Career & Social Settings
In Career or Business:
- This person is financially savvy, consistent, and reliable
- They’re likely to be in roles that involve planning, budgeting, building, or investing
- They bring stability to teams, preferring routines over chaos
- May be self-employed or focused on long-term business visions
Work Behavior | Examples |
---|---|
Slow and strategic | They don’t rush projects—they build success over time |
Disciplined and resourceful | Manages time and money well—great for startups, finance, or earthwork |
Reward-focused | Driven by tangible results, job security, or helping others gain value |
Generous with skills | Offers mentorship, tools, or resources that create real transformation |
In Social & Friendship Circles:
- The “quiet rock” in your friend group
- Doesn’t seek attention, but always shows up when you need help
- Likely the one with the most savings, least gossip, and most dependable advice
- May not text every day—but when they do, it’s meaningful and practical
